HTML表单基础与网页设计关键概念

需积分: 17 14 下载量 101 浏览量 更新于2024-08-14 收藏 3.69MB PPT 举报
"极品html课件,涵盖HTML基础、CSS样式表和JavaScript,旨在教授基本的网页设计和实现静态个人网站。" 在学习HTML(超文本标记语言)的过程中,表单扮演着至关重要的角色。表单(form)是网页中用于收集用户数据的工具,如在用户注册或购物时输入个人信息和支付详情。HTML表单允许网页与用户进行交互,收集和发送数据到服务器进行处理。 表单的基本元素包括各种输入字段(input elements),如文本框(text fields)、密码框(password fields)、单选按钮(radio buttons)、复选框(checkboxes)、下拉列表(dropdown lists)以及提交按钮(submit buttons)。这些元素通过不同的HTML标签定义,如`<input>`、`<textarea>`、`<select>`和`<button>`。 为了使表单美观且易于阅读,通常会结合使用CSS(层叠样式表)来控制元素的样式,如字体、颜色、布局和背景。CSS允许开发者精细地调整表单的视觉效果,使其符合网站的整体设计。 JavaScript是另一个关键的辅助技术,它提供了动态功能,如验证用户输入、改变表单元素的状态或者在无需刷新页面的情况下更新内容。JavaScript可以用来检查用户是否已填写必填字段,或者确保输入的数据格式正确,比如邮箱地址或电话号码。 了解HTTP(超文本传输协议)也很重要,因为它是浏览器与服务器之间通信的基础。当用户在浏览器中输入URL并提交表单时,HTTP负责将请求(request)发送到服务器,并接收服务器的响应(response)。这个过程是无状态的,意味着每次请求都是独立的,不保留任何关于先前交互的信息。 在HTML中,每个元素都有属性(attribute),这些属性提供了额外的信息,比如`<input>`元素的`type`属性可以指定输入类型,如`type="text"`创建一个文本输入字段,`type="email"`则用于验证电子邮件地址。 学习HTML时,掌握基本的英语词汇也很有帮助,例如,`Client`指的是浏览器,`Document`代表网页文件,`Attribute`是元素的属性,而`Form`就是我们讨论的表单。 这个“极品html课件”将引导学习者从基础开始,逐步掌握HTML的标记语言,理解CSS样式化网页的方法,以及使用JavaScript增强用户体验。通过这个课程,你可以学会设计和实现自己的静态个人网站,这包括创建表单、处理用户输入和构建响应式布局等技能。